1. How does an air conditioner cool the room?

Every air conditioner follows a simple thermodynamic process:

  • The compressor circulates refrigerant through the coils.
  • The evaporator coil absorbs indoor heat.
  • The condenser coil releases that heat outdoors.

Once you start the unit, it needs a few minutes for refrigerant pressure and fan speed to stabilise. Only then can it start cooling effectively.

If your air conditioner is cooling too slowly, that delay may simply mean the unit is ramping up, especially after sitting idle during winter.

2. How long should it take to cool a room?

On average, most modern systems need 20–30 minutes to lower room temperature to the set level.
However, this depends on:

  • Outdoor temperature: when Gold Coast days exceed 35–40°C, cooling may take up to 40 minutes.
  • Room size and insulation: larger, sun-exposed rooms naturally take longer.
  • System type and condition: inverter systems reach set temperatures faster than non-inverter units.

If your air conditioner still struggles after 30–40 minutes, that’s a sign it needs cleaning or inspection.

4. Why your air conditioner is cooling too slowly (and how to fix it)

A. Old or unmaintained system

Dust, mould, and debris block airflow and prevent proper heat exchange. Regular HydroClean servicing can restore performance and air quality.

B. Wrong size or placement

An undersized AC will struggle in larger rooms, especially those exposed to direct sunlight. Proper installation by an experienced air conditioning Gold Coast team ensures correct capacity and placement.

C. Hot room conditions

Poor insulation or sun-facing windows make it harder for your system to stabilise. Use curtains, shading, or reflective films to reduce load.

D. Refrigerant or mechanical issues

If cooling remains weak after 30–40 minutes, you could be dealing with a refrigerant leak or failing compressor. These require professional inspection – don’t attempt DIY fixes.
